New Showbiz Analysis

Tommy Boy operates as a traditional comedy that upholds established social hierarchies. Although it slightly challenges the typical masculine stereotype through its protagonist, the film’s emphasis on traditional family structures limits its progressive impact. The film’s main conflict between small businesses and large corporations offers a localized critique of capitalism. However, it does not address broader systemic issues related to Western institutions. Overall, the absence of diverse racial, LGBTQ+, and characters who reflect more than one aspect of diversity aligns the film with traditional storytelling conventions.

Does Tommy Boy have LGBTQ+ representation?

Minimal

The film does not include any LGBTQ+ characters or explore non-traditional gender identities. The social environment focuses solely on heterosexual relationships.

How does Tommy Boy portray gender?

Fair

Tommy Callahan challenges typical masculine stereotypes through his emotional sensitivity and awkwardness. However, the storyline emphasizes patriarchal traditions by focusing on restoring a family legacy.

How racially and ethnically diverse is Tommy Boy?

Minimal

The cast predominantly features white actors representing a specific working-class demographic in the American Midwest. There is no diversity in terms of race or ethnicity.

How does Tommy Boy represent religion and culture?

Fair

The story critiques corporate dominance, contrasting local businesses with impersonal capitalism. It upholds traditional Western values such as family loyalty and the importance of father-son bonds.

Does Tommy Boy include disability representation?

Limited

Physical clumsiness and social ineptitude are used mainly for comedic effect. These traits do not delve into the complexities of neurodiversity or real-life disabilities.
